Kings Road is in Bournemouth and in Bournemouth district. BH3 7LD is located in the Winton East elect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Bournemouth West.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. The area surrounding BH3 7LD has a slightly higher male population, with 50% of residents being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ate area around BH3 7LD,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 60.2%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Health

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.

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.

This area has a high perc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(87.6%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either a younger population or more affluent area.

Safety

Is Kings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Kings Road was 102.5 per 1,000 residents, which is 11.3% lower than the East Cliff & Springbourne average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.

Kings Road has the 15th highest crime rate of 43 local areas in East Cliff & Springbourne and the 293rd highest crime rate of 1,191 local areas in Bournemouth, Christchurch and Poole .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 47.5 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-82.7%.
